One of the first and most important steps in choosing an online casino is to verify its licensing and regulation. A legitimate online casino operates under a license issued by a respected regulatory body. These bodies, such as the United Kingdom Gambling Commission (UKGC) or the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), impose strict standards on operators, ensuring fair play, player protection, and responsible gambling practices. Without proper licensing, an operator lacks accountability and presents a significantly higher risk to players. Players should always check the casino’s website for licensing information, typically found in the footer. A valid license number provides a degree of reassurance regarding the casino’s adherence to industry standards.
The role of these regulatory bodies extends beyond simply issuing licenses. They also investigate player complaints, enforce penalties for breaches of regulations, and regularly audit casinos to ensure compliance. This ongoing oversight contributes to a safer and more transparent online gambling environment. Furthermore, licensed casinos are often required to implement measures to prevent money laundering and protect vulnerable individuals. Looking for accreditation from independent testing agencies, such as eCOGRA, can provide additional confidence, as these agencies verify the fairness of the casino’s games and payout percentages.
Beyond licensing, examining the security measures employed by an online casino is paramount. Reputable casinos utilize advanced encryption technology, such as SSL (Secure Socket Layer), to protect sensitive data, including personal and financial information. This encryption ensures that data transmitted between your device and the casino's servers is unreadable to unauthorized parties. Look for “https” in the website address, indicating a secure connection.
A robust security infrastructure also encompasses measures to prevent fraud and unauthorized access. Casinos should employ firewalls, intrusion detection systems, and regular security audits to safeguard against cyber threats. Responsible operators will also have clear policies regarding data privacy and will comply with relevant data protection regulations, such as GDPR (General Data Protection Regulation). Reviewing the casino's privacy policy is crucial to understanding how your information is collected, used, and protected. It's always a good practice to use strong, unique passwords and enable two-factor authentication where available.

Online casinos frequently entice players with bonuses and promotions, ranging from welcome offers to loyalty rewards. While these can be attractive, it's crucial to understand the terms and conditions attached to them. In particular, wagering requirements are a key factor to consider. Wagering requirements, sometimes referred to as play-through requirements, specify the amount of money you must wager before you can withdraw any winnings earned from a bonus. A typical wagering requirement might be 35x the bonus amount, meaning you need to wager 35 times the bonus value before withdrawing. These requirements can significantly impact your ability to cash out winnings.
Beyond wagering requirements, pay attention to game weighting. Not all games contribute equally towards fulfilling the wagering requirements. Slots generally contribute 100%, while table games like blackjack or roulette might contribute a smaller percentage, such as 10% or 20%. This means you need to wager more on table games to meet the requirements. Additionally, there may be maximum bet limits while playing with bonus funds. Exceeding these limits could void your bonus and any associated winnings. A thorough understanding of the bonus terms is essential to avoid disappointment and ensure you can actually benefit from the offer. The world of casino bonuses is diverse. Deposit bonuses are the most common, matching a percentage of your deposit with bonus funds. No-deposit bonuses offer a small amount of credit without requiring a deposit, but they typically come with higher wagering requirements. Free spins are another popular type, allowing you to play specific slot games without using your own funds. Cashback bonuses return a percentage of your losses, providing a safety net.
Loyalty programs reward frequent players with points that can be redeemed for bonuses or other perks. Understanding the nuances of each bonus type is crucial. For instance, a high-percentage deposit bonus with steep wagering requirements might be less advantageous than a smaller bonus with more reasonable terms. Always compare offers carefully and prioritize bonuses that align with your playing style and risk tolerance.
Remember to read the fine print and consider the long-term value of a bonus before claiming it.
Gambling should be approached as a form of entertainment, not a source of income. Responsible gaming involves setting limits, managing your bankroll effectively, and recognizing the signs of problem gambling. Establishing a budget before you start playing is crucial. Decide how much money you can afford to lose without impacting your financial stability, and stick to that limit. Never chase losses – attempting to recoup lost funds can lead to a downward spiral.
Utilize the tools offered by online casinos to help you manage your gambling. These include de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ion options. Deposit limits restrict the amount of money you can deposit into your account within a specified period. Loss limits cap the amount you can lose over a given timeframe. Self-exclusion allows you to voluntarily ban yourself from the casino for a predetermined period. These tools are designed to help you stay in control and prevent excessive gambling. If you feel like you are losing control, seek help from organizations dedicated to problem gambling support.
Effective bankroll management is essential for extending your playtime and minimizing risk. A common strategy is to divide your bankroll into smaller units and bet only a small percentage of your bankroll on each wager. This helps you weather losing streaks and avoid depleting your funds quickly. Another strategy is to set win goals and stop playing once you reach them. This prevents you from giving back your winnings out of greed. Recognizing when to quit, whether you're winning or losing, is a hallmark of responsible gambling.
Understanding the concept of variance is also important. Variance refers to the fluctuations in your winnings and losses. Some games have high variance, meaning payouts are infrequent but potentially large, while others have low variance, offering more frequent but smaller payouts. Choosing games that align with your risk tolerance is crucial. If you prefer a more steady experience, opt for low-variance games. If you're comfortable with more risk, high-variance games might be appealing, but be prepared for longer losing streaks.
